The St. Louis Cardinals (32-28) will go up against the Cincinnati Reds (31-30) at Busch Stadium on Saturday. The moneyline on this game has Cincinnati at -122 and St. Louis is priced at +102. The over/under is set at 9. The pitchers taking the mound will be Nick Lodolo and Matthew Liberatore.

As a squad, the Cincinnati Reds are scoring 4.3 runs per outing, which has them sitting at 15th in baseball. They have earned 264 runs scored and hold an OBP of .312. The Reds have accrued 98 doubles as a team and have hit 77 baseballs out of the park. They have recorded 249 RBI's in addition to 468 base knocks for the year, while their team batting average is at .229. Cincinnati is slugging .395 and have struck out 573 times, while drawing a walk on 236 occasions.

The Reds have compiled a team ERA of 4.76 over the course of the season (27th in the league), and their staff has struck out 476 batters. Reds pitchers have given up 88 home runs and 305 runs in total (24th in MLB). Their pitching staff has walked 279 opposing batters and their FIP comes in at 5.14 as a unit over the course of the season. Cincinnati has surrendered 515 base hits (8.5 per 9 innings) as well as 289 earned runs. They have earned a K/BB ratio of 1.71 and their pitching staff holds a collective WHIP of 1.45.
Reds bullpen pitchers have entered the contest with runners on base 64 times and also have had 67 appearances in high leverage situations. The bullpen have a total of 41 holds for the season (6th in the league). The Reds relievers have compiled a save rate of 58.3% and have come into the game in 66 save situations. They have earned 14 saves on the year and have blown 10 of 24 save opportunities. The relievers have inherited 87 runners so far this year and 28.7% of them earned a run for their team. The Reds have dispatched 225 relief pitchers to the hill this season.
The Reds have transformed 71.2% of baseballs in play into outs out of 4,917 innings on the field, which has them sitting 9th in the majors. The Cincinnati Reds have accumulated 1,639 putouts thus far, as well as 504 assists and 26 errors. Their fielding percentage is currently at .988 which is 7th in baseball, and have a total of 51 double plays.
Lodolo has taken the mound for 436 innings and is sitting with 478 punch outs during his pro baseball career. Lodolo (26-23 career win-loss mark) has a FIP of 4.08 while going up against 1,862 opposing hitters during his time in the majors. His earned run average is 4.15 (201 ER's allowed) and his career WHIP is 1.224. He has conceded 404 hits (8.3 hits per 9 innings) and has had 130 free passes.
St. Louis has recorded 65 home runs so far this season and 250 runs batted in. They have put up 84 two-baggers, while getting a free base 195 times as well as putting up 257 runs. The St. Louis Cardinals have an OBP of .317 as well as a batting average of .240 over the course of the season. The Cardinals have a team SLG% of .384 and they score 4.28 runs per contest (17th in MLB). They have been rung up on 487 occasions (23rd in MLB) and have notched a total of 484 base hits.
The Cardinals hold a team WHIP of 1.357 and are the owners of a FIP of 4.20 as a team on the year. They come in at 24th in MLB as a pitching staff in total hits given up with 521. The St. Louis pitching staff have given up 269 runs on the year while having an ERA of 4.15 (249 earned runs relinquished). Their strikeout to walk ratio sits at 7.70 (465 strikeouts vs 212 walks). They have surrendered 61 long balls and they allow 4.48 runs per 9 innings (15th in baseball).
With 80 save situations, the Cardinals have accumulated 48 holds in addition to 10 blown saves. St. Louis has called on bullpen pitchers to step onto the mound in 30 save chances and they have recorded 20 saves. St. Louis relievers hold an inherited score rate of 34.0% of 97 inherited runners. Their bullpen pitchers have come in 75 times in high leverage situations and also on 68 occasions with runners on. They are ranked 13th in baseball holding a save percentage of 66.7%, and they have sent 211 relievers onto the diamond so far this season.
The St. Louis Cardinals have gotten 58 double plays and hold a fielding percentage of .986 (18th in baseball). The Cardinals have recorded 566 assists, 31 errors and have accounted for 1,622 putouts so far this season. In 4,866 innings played, the Cardinals have earned a defensive efficiency of 69.2% (24th in pro baseball).
Liberatore (19-27 career record) has a 4.59 ERA and has conceded 9.5 hits per nine innings. He has a K/BB ratio of 2.46 and he has gone up against 1,710 opposing batters during his MLB career. He has allowed a total of 202 earned runs while holding a WHIP of 1.391 and a FIP of 4.5. In his MLB career, Liberatore has allowed 417 hits while he has earned 329 punch outs in 396 frames.
